Dream - Many assume that the significant age gap between siblings makes their relationship not very close. This is because their playing phase is no longer the same, even though it is not always the case.
The older siblings who are much older sometimes really enjoy having a younger sibling who can actually be their entertainer. This also includes the possibility of having the smallest person to be ordered around.
As shown on the Instagram account @rakyandilantara. An older brother named Ichsan Sahrul likes to create daily content with his much younger siblings who have a significant age difference with him.
Ichsan has a younger sibling who is a toddler, where the age difference between them reaches 24 years, named Rakyan. This is because their father and mother got married young and now he has a younger sibling.
In the shared photos and videos, Rakyan revealed that he accompanied his mother to the doctor for a check-up when she was pregnant with his two younger siblings who were still small. He even accompanied his mother during childbirth and helped take care of his sibling.
As the oldest brother, Ichsan feels responsible for his younger siblings. He also loves to play with Rakyan, who is still a toddler, and even looks like a father and son.
In many videos and photos, Ichsan shares the fun of playing with his younger siblings. The age gap is not a barrier for Ichsan to enjoy moments with his sibling. Many netizens commented on Ichsan's sweet attitude because he is so attentive and diligent in taking care of his younger sibling.
